我可以用Go编程语言编写一个简单的程序来计算两个数的和。
以下是一个简单的Go程序,用于计算两个数的和:
```gopackage main
import fmt
func main { var num1, num2 int fmt.Print fmt.Scan fmt.Print fmt.Scan sum := num1 num2 fmt.Printf}```
这个程序首先导入了`fmt`包,用于输入输出。在`main`函数中,它声明了两个变量`num1`和`num2`来存储用户输入的两个数。它使用`fmt.Print`函数提示用户输入第一个数,并使用`fmt.Scan`函数读取用户的输入。同样的过程也用于第二个数。程序计算两个数的和,并使用`fmt.Printf`函数将结果输出到控制台。
一、探索“go”的多样用法
在英语中,“go”是一个基础且多功能的动词,其用法广泛,可以从简单的移动到复杂的抽象表达。本文将探讨“go”的不同用法,并通过具体例句展示其在不同语境中的运用。
二、基本用法:表示移动或前进
- He went to the store to buy some groceries.(他去了商店买了一些杂货。)
- The children are going to the park for a picnic.(孩子们要去公园野餐。)
- She went to the library to study for her exams.(她去图书馆为考试做准备。)
三、短语动词:结合其他动词形成短语
“Go”可以与其他动词结合形成短语动词,表达更具体的动作。
- He went ahead and made the decision without consulting anyone.(他未经咨询就自行做出了决定。)
- She went on a trip to Japan last summer.(她去年夏天去了日本旅行。)
- They went out for dinner after work.(他们下班后出去吃饭。)
四、抽象用法:表示发生或进行
“Go”还可以用来表示抽象概念,如事件的发生或过程的进行。
- The project is going smoothly.(项目进展顺利。)
- Peace talks between the two countries are going on.(两国之间的和平谈判正在进行。)
- His career has gone from strength to strength.(他的事业一直在稳步上升。)
五、时态变化:过去式和过去分词
- They went to the movies last night.(他们昨晚去看电影了。)
- After the party, we were all gone home.(聚会结束后,我们都回家了。)
- She has gone to the market to buy some fresh vegetables.(她已经去市场买了一些新鲜蔬菜。)
六、短语和句式:结合其他短语和句式使用
“Go”可以与各种短语和句式结合,形成丰富的表达。
- Go ahead and try it.(尽管试试看。)
- Go for it!(加油!去做吧!)
- Go back to the drawing board.(回到原点重新设计。)
通过本文的探讨,我们可以看到“go”作为一个基础动词,其用法之广泛和多样性。掌握“go”的不同用法,有助于我们更准确地表达思想,丰富我们的语言表达。